About Kamshet & its bio diversity

Kamshet is a region located in Pune district in the state of Maharashtra, India, 110 km from Mumbai City, and 45 km from Pune in Pune district. It is 16 km from the twin hill stations of Khandala and Lonavala[1]and is accessible by road and rail from Mumbai (Bombay) and Pune. Kamshet is home to small villages that are built in the traditional style – with mud, thatch and reeds.

Nestled in Maharashtra, Kamshet’s biodiversity is a tapestry woven from its diverse landscapes. Lush forests, ranging from tropical evergreens to deciduous varieties, harbor an array of flora, including towering teak trees and valuable medicinal plants. This verdant habitat sustains a thriving wildlife population, from elusive leopards and graceful deer to an avian symphony of hornbills, sunbirds, and migratory species.

Water bodies like rivers and lakes host a bustling aquatic community, with freshwater fish darting among submerged vegetation and crustaceans scuttling along the shores. Insects, from delicate butterflies to industrious ants, animate the air and ground, performing vital roles in pollination and decomposition.

Kamshet’s significance deepens as part of the Western Ghats, renowned for its endemism. Rare plant and animal species find sanctuary here, underscoring the region’s importance in global biodiversity conservation efforts. As guardians of this natural treasure trove, stewardship and sustainable practices are paramount to ensure Kamshet’s ecological wealth endures for generations to come.

The Fireflies phenomenon

There are about 2,000 firefly species. These insects live in a variety of warm environments, as well as in more temperate regions. They are a familiar sight on summer evenings. Fireflies love moisture and often live in humid regions of Asia and the Americas. In drier areas, they are found around wet or damp areas that retain moisture.

This phenomenon usually takes place just before the main monsoon arrives and after the first showers.

Light and chemical production

Light production in fireflies is due to a type of chemical reaction called bioluminescence. This process occurs in specialized light-emitting organs, usually on a firefly’s lower abdomen.  The enzyme luciferase acts on the luciferin, in the presence of magnesium ions, ATP, and oxygen to produce light.

Light in adult beetles was originally thought to be used for similar warning purposes. Now its primary purpose is thought to be used in mate selection. Fireflies are a classic example of an organism that uses bioluminescence for sexual selection.

How to reach :

  • Reaching Kamshet:
  • By Air:
    Fly to Pune Airport (PNQ), then take a taxi or ride-sharing service for a 1.5 to 2-hour journey.
  • By Road:
    Drive from Mumbai or Pune via the Mumbai-Pune Expressway or old Mumbai-Pune Highway, taking around 2.5 to 3.5 hours from Mumbai and 1.5 to 2 hours from Pune. Buses are also available.
  • By Train:
    Take a train to Lonavala Railway Station, then a taxi or local bus for a 30-minute to 1-hour journey to Kamshet.
